Broken window repair services involve the removal and replacement of damaged or broken glass panes in residential or commercial properties. This process typically includes assessing the extent of the damage, carefully removing the broken glass, and installing a new, properly fitted window to restore the property's appearance and functionality. Professionals may also address any framing or structural issues that contribute to the window's damage, ensuring a secure and durable repair.

Addressing a broken window can help prevent further damage to the property, such as water intrusion, drafts, or pest entry. It also enhances security by eliminating vulnerabilities that could be exploited. Additionally, repairing broken windows improves energy efficiency by maintaining proper insulation, which can lead to lower utility costs. Restoring the window’s integrity also contributes to the overall aesthetic appeal of the building.

This service is commonly utilized in a variety of property types, including single-family homes, apartment complexes, retail storefronts, and office buildings. Commercial properties often require prompt repairs to minimize disruption and maintain safety standards. Residential properties benefit from timely repairs to uphold security and comfort, especially when windows are shattered or severely cracked.

Professionals offering broken window repair services are equipped to handle different types of glass, including standard, tempered, or insulated panes. They are experienced in working with diverse window styles, from traditional sash windows to modern casement designs. The overview below groups typical Broken Window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Essex County, NJ.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Window Repair - Repair costs typically range from $150 to $400 per window, depending on the extent of damage and window size. Small cracks or minor damages are usually on the lower end of this range.

Frame Replacement - Replacing window frames can cost between $300 and $800 per window, with higher prices for custom or specialty materials. The price varies based on frame material and window size.

Glass Replacement - Replacing broken glass panes generally costs between $100 and $350 per window. Costs depend on glass type, size, and whether additional repairs are needed.

Emergency Repair Services - Emergency broken window repairs may range from $200 to $600, depending on the urgency and complexity of the damage. These services often include quick response and temporary fixes.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a window to break? Common causes include impacts from objects, severe weather conditions, thermal stress, or accidental damage.

How quickly can broken window repair services be scheduled? Availability varies by local providers; contacting a professional can help determine scheduling options.

Can a cracked window be repaired instead of replaced? In some cases, minor cracks can be repaired, but extensive damage typically requires full replacement.

What are the benefits of repairing a broken window promptly? Immediate repairs can prevent further damage, improve security, and maintain energy efficiency.
